Unraveling the Shelf Life Mystery

At the heart of it, the shelf life of Xanax, or its generic counterpart, alprazolam, is a topic entwined with both legal and health implications. According to the pharmaceutical mavericks and regulatory guidelines, the standard shelf life stamped on most Xanax packages is about 2 to 3 years from the date of manufacture. But here’s the kicker – this time frame isn’t a hard stop. It’s more like the manufacturer’s promise that until this date, Xanax will perform at its peak, retaining its potency and safety.

Beyond the Expiration Date

Venturing past the expiration date is like stepping into a gray zone. It’s not quite the Wild West, but it’s not FDA-approved territory either. Studies, including one from the U.S. Department of Defense/FDA Shelf Life Extension Program, have shown many medications remain effective and safe well beyond their official expiration dates, provided they are stored correctly. However, this doesn’t mean one should make a habit of hoarding and using expired medications. The efficiency of Xanax might wane over time, meaning it’s not working as tirelessly in your corner as it once was.

For those who find an old bottle nestled in the back of the medicine cabinet, the best advice is to play it safe. While an expired Xanax might not morph into a dangerous concoction, its efficacy might have dwindled to the point of being a placebo.

Proper Storage: A Key Player

Speaking of peak performance, let’s not underestimate the role of proper storage. Like a fine wine that demands optimal conditions, Xanax’s longevity is significantly affected by where and how it’s stored. Keeping it in a cool, dry place away from sunlight can help preserve its strength. Let’s just say, the medicine cabinet in your steamy bathroom might not be its ideal hangout spot.
